¿Qué es Nova Launcher? Análisis Técnico
Nova Launcher es un framework de lanzamiento web que implementa una arquitectura de eventos reactivos para gestionar el ciclo de vida de aplicaciones. A diferencia de soluciones monolíticas, Nova Launcher utiliza un sistema de módulos independientes que se comunican mediante un bus de eventos centralizado.
Conceptos Fundamentales
- Arquitectura de Eventos: Cada componente emite y consume eventos, desacoplando la lógica de negocio de la presentación.
- Gestión de Estado Reactivo: El estado se propaga automáticamente a través de suscriptores, eliminando la necesidad de prop drilling.
- Módulos Autónomos: Cada módulo puede ser desarrollado, probado e implementado de forma independiente.
Diferencias con Alternativas
Comparado con React o Vue, Nova Launcher ofrece mayor flexibilidad para aplicaciones híbridas donde diferentes partes necesitan diferentes tecnologías. Su sistema de plugins permite integrar componentes de distintos frameworks sin conflictos.
- Arquitectura basada en eventos para desacoplamiento
- Gestión de estado reactivo sin prop drilling
- Módulos autónomos con ciclo de vida independiente
- Sistema de plugins para integración multi-framework
Por Qué Importa Nova Launcher: Impacto Empresarial
Nova Launcher resuelve problemas críticos en desarrollo web empresarial: el acoplamiento excesivo, la complejidad de estado y la dificultad de escalar aplicaciones legado. Su arquitectura permite modernizar gradualmente sin reescribir todo el sistema.
Casos de Uso Empresariales
- Modernización Gradual: Empresas pueden reemplazar componentes monolíticos con módulos Nova Launcher sin interrumpir operaciones.
- Integración Multi-Framework: Organizaciones con diferentes equipos usando React, Angular o Vue pueden coexistir en la misma aplicación.
- Aplicaciones de Alta Escala: Sistemas con miles de componentes se benefician de la desacoplamiento y gestión de estado eficiente.
Impacto Medible
Empresas reportan reducciones del 30-40% en tiempo de desarrollo de nuevas funcionalidades gracias a la reutilización de módulos. La capacidad de aislar fallos a módulos específicos reduce el tiempo de resolución de incidentes hasta un 60%.
"La arquitectura de Nova Launcher nos permitió dividir una aplicación monolítica de 500k líneas de código en 50 módulos independientes, reduciendo el tiempo de despliegue de 2 horas a 15 minutos." - Informe de implementación
- Modernización gradual sin interrupciones
- Integración de múltiples frameworks
- Reducción de tiempo de desarrollo (30-40%)
- Aislamiento de fallos para mayor resiliencia
Newsletter · Gratis
Más insights sobre Nova Launcher cada semana
Únete a 2,400+ profesionales. Sin spam, 1 email por semana.
Consultoría directa
Reserva 15 minutos: te decimos si merece un piloto
Nada de slides eternos: contexto, riesgos y un siguiente paso concreto (o te decimos que no encaja).
Cuándo Usar Nova Launcher: Mejores Prácticas
Nova Launcher es ideal para proyectos complejos con múltiples equipos, aplicaciones que requieren modernización gradual, o sistemas donde la flexibilidad tecnológica es crítica. No es recomendable para proyectos simples o equipos unificados con una tecnología.
Guía de Implementación
- Evaluación Inicial: Analiza la arquitectura actual y identifica módulos candidatos para migración.
- Piloto: Implementa Nova Launcher en un módulo no crítico primero.
- Integración: Conecta el módulo con el sistema existente mediante eventos.
- Escalado: Migrar módulos adicionales basado en métricas de rendimiento.
Mejores Prácticas
- Eventos Documentados: Mantén un catálogo centralizado de eventos y sus payloads.
- Pruebas Unitarias: Aísla módulos con pruebas independientes del núcleo.
- Monitoreo: Implementa métricas para eventos y rendimiento de módulos.
- Versionado: Usa semver para módulos y eventos públicos.
Errores Comunes a Evitar
- No crear eventos demasiado granulares (problema de microservicios).
- Ignorar la documentación de contratos entre módulos.
- Implementar lógica de negocio en el núcleo (debe permanecer en módulos).
- Ideal para aplicaciones complejas y multi-framework
- Piloto inicial en módulo no crítico
- Documentación exhaustiva de eventos
- Aislamiento total de pruebas por módulo

Semsei — posiciona e indexa contenido con IA
Tecnología experimental en evolución: genera y estructura páginas orientadas a keywords, acelera la indexación y refuerza la marca en búsquedas asistidas por IA. Oferta preferente para equipos pioneros que quieren resultados mientras cofináis con feedback el desarrollo del producto.